[yt-svn] commit/yt: 2 new changesets
commits-noreply at bitbucket.org
commits-noreply at bitbucket.org
Fri Jan 31 13:58:26 PST 2014
2 new commits in yt:
https://bitbucket.org/yt_analysis/yt/commits/298bccbb954d/
Changeset: 298bccbb954d
Branch: yt-3.0
User: MatthewTurk
Date: 2014-01-31 20:44:08
Summary: Adding base_dx padding for covering grids. Closes #763.
Affected #: 1 file
diff -r bef9fef757203244246d8ec500891fc424f31658 -r 298bccbb954d3afc6d5e6f7f3de2b0ee78825e21 yt/data_objects/construction_data_containers.py
--- a/yt/data_objects/construction_data_containers.py
+++ b/yt/data_objects/construction_data_containers.py
@@ -409,6 +409,7 @@
rdx = self.pf.domain_dimensions*self.pf.relative_refinement(0, level)
rdx[np.where(dims - 2 * num_ghost_zones <= 1)] = 1 # issue 602
+ self.base_dds = self.pf.domain_width / self.pf.domain_dimensions
self.dds = self.pf.domain_width / rdx.astype("float64")
self.ActiveDimensions = np.array(dims, dtype='int32')
self.right_edge = self.left_edge + self.ActiveDimensions*self.dds
@@ -456,8 +457,9 @@
return tuple(self.ActiveDimensions.tolist())
def _setup_data_source(self):
- self._data_source = self.pf.h.region(
- self.center, self.left_edge, self.right_edge)
+ self._data_source = self.pf.h.region(self.center,
+ self.left_edge - self.base_dds,
+ self.right_edge + self.base_dds)
self._data_source.min_level = 0
self._data_source.max_level = self.level
https://bitbucket.org/yt_analysis/yt/commits/6120c77c828f/
Changeset: 6120c77c828f
Branch: yt-3.0
User: ngoldbaum
Date: 2014-01-31 22:58:19
Summary: Merged in MatthewTurk/yt/yt-3.0 (pull request #700)
Adding base_dx padding for covering grids. Closes #763.
Affected #: 1 file
diff -r 917374ee07f8f7685e0130a253559ef10ed9380c -r 6120c77c828f195f8691806fc724bb730fe90680 yt/data_objects/construction_data_containers.py
--- a/yt/data_objects/construction_data_containers.py
+++ b/yt/data_objects/construction_data_containers.py
@@ -409,6 +409,7 @@
rdx = self.pf.domain_dimensions*self.pf.relative_refinement(0, level)
rdx[np.where(dims - 2 * num_ghost_zones <= 1)] = 1 # issue 602
+ self.base_dds = self.pf.domain_width / self.pf.domain_dimensions
self.dds = self.pf.domain_width / rdx.astype("float64")
self.ActiveDimensions = np.array(dims, dtype='int32')
self.right_edge = self.left_edge + self.ActiveDimensions*self.dds
@@ -456,8 +457,9 @@
return tuple(self.ActiveDimensions.tolist())
def _setup_data_source(self):
- self._data_source = self.pf.h.region(
- self.center, self.left_edge, self.right_edge)
+ self._data_source = self.pf.h.region(self.center,
+ self.left_edge - self.base_dds,
+ self.right_edge + self.base_dds)
self._data_source.min_level = 0
self._data_source.max_level = self.level
Repository URL: https://bitbucket.org/yt_analysis/yt/
--
This is a commit notification from bitbucket.org. You are receiving
this because you have the service enabled, addressing the recipient of
this email.
More information about the yt-svn
mailing list